LLC LOANS. LLC Loans" shall refer to any loans or advances made by any Member to the LLC at the Member's option, without obligation to so do, to the extent the LLC does not have sufficient resources (assets, borrowings or otherwise) to meet its LLC obligations. Such LLC Loans shall bear interest at the rate agreed to between the Member and the Manager.
